Spoonfuls of Sugary Love


I saw these sweet spoon treats in Family Fun magazine and figured they would be a nice after school treat for C and R.


To make them, I began by melting white chocolate according to the package directions.  Then I spooned the melted chocolate into a resealable bag, snipped the corner, and piped it onto the spoons.  You could just spoon it on, but piping made the whole process and the final result a lot neater.  I added Valentine sprinkles and let it harden.


They were perfectly delicious stirred into hot cocoa.
